How does a regulated liability network ensure the security of digital assets in the cryptocurrency market?

- A regulated liability network ensures the security of digital assets in the cryptocurrency market by implementing strict regulatory measures. These measures include KYC (Know Your Customer) procedures, AML (Anti-Money Laundering) policies, and regular audits to ensure compliance with legal and financial regulations. Additionally, the network may employ advanced security technologies such as multi-factor authentication, encryption, and cold storage to protect digital assets from unauthorized access and potential cyber attacks. By establishing a transparent and accountable framework, a regulated liability network helps to build trust among users and provides a secure environment for trading and storing digital assets.

- When it comes to securing digital assets in the cryptocurrency market, a regulated liability network plays a crucial role. By enforcing regulations and implementing robust security measures, such as secure custody solutions and strict identity verification processes, the network ensures that only authorized individuals can access and transact with digital assets. This helps to prevent fraud, money laundering, and other illicit activities. Additionally, the network may collaborate with cybersecurity experts and adopt industry best practices to stay ahead of emerging threats. By prioritizing security, a regulated liability network instills confidence in users and contributes to the overall stability of the cryptocurrency market.
